,可以通过以下步骤完成:
[attribute]
选择器来选取具有特定属性的元素,例如[alt]
表示选取具有alt属性的元素。.attr()
方法获取选取元素的alt属性值。.attr()
方法用于获取或设置元素的属性值。.data()
方法来为选取的元素添加数据。.data()
方法可以将数据附加到元素上,以供后续使用。.data(key, value)
方法将数据附加到元素上,其中key表示数据的键名,value表示数据的值。下面是一个示例代码:
// 选取具有alt属性的元素
var $element = $('[alt]');
// 获取alt属性值
var altValue = $element.attr('alt');
// 创建新的数据元素并附加数据
var $dataElement = $('<div>').data('altValue', altValue);
// 输出数据元素
console.log($dataElement);
在这个示例中,我们使用了jQuery选择器$('[alt]')
选取具有alt属性的元素,然后使用.attr('alt')
方法获取alt属性值。接下来,我们使用$('<div>')
创建了一个新的div元素,并使用.data('altValue', altValue)
方法将获取到的alt属性值作为数据附加到新创建的元素上。最后,我们通过console.log($dataElement)
输出了包含数据的新元素。
这个方法适用于任何具有alt属性的元素,并且可以根据需要进行修改和扩展。
领取专属 10元无门槛券
手把手带您无忧上云